Multi-block relief printmaking uses a separate block for each color. The carved areas fit together like puzzle pieces and are printed in succession onto the paper. Reduction relief printmaking uses only one block, slowly carving it away as each layer is printed on top of the one before. The final layer is usually the black outline, and it will have every other color printed underneath it.
